## Deploying the Gatewick Proctor Queue

Deploys are pretty painless: push to main, wait for the pipeline, then watch the queue drain dashboard for five minutes. If candidates pile up mid-exam, roll back first and ask questions later — the queue replays safely. Everything the workers care about lives in one config block, shown here for reference.

settings of bafof-yagef:
JOROX_PIN=8740
JOROX_TENANT=pelox
JOROX_METRICS_HOST=metrics.jorox.qorvelworks.internal
JOROX_SEAL=seal_c78f63c1
JOROX_STANDBY_TEAM=norax

Hi Marit — cut-over for the Ladlewise recipe-scaling calculator is done. We flipped traffic to the new scaling engine at 09:10, old endpoints are in read-only mode for a week, then gone. Fraction rounding now matches the spec, and the unit-conversion cache warmed up faster than expected. One hiccup with metric/imperial toggles, patched before lunch. For your records, the production service is currently running with the configuration values below.

service settings:
novath:
  pin: 1396
  tenant: pelys
  seal: seal_ccc035e1
  metrics_host: metrics.novath.qorvelworks.test
  standby_team: fraeth
  escalation: drueth-zorok
  nonce: 61d508

Onboarding: Splitwick assignment service

Splitwick assigns users to A/B experiment buckets at request time for the Fernlake apps. New engineers should clone the service repo and copy env.sample to .env. Most defaults work locally; set ASSIGNMENT_SALT_ROTATION to weekly. The service signs bucket assignments with a key, and that signing credential is set on the following line.

env line for fafof-fahag: LEDGER_TOKEN5=f8790

This page summarises the pending budget request you will inherit as incoming director. Operations has asked for a 14% uplift to complete the Corvano rollout across the Hartvale and Ossmere branches, covering licensing, two contract engineers, and warehouse scanner replacements. Finance has provisionally endorsed the figure but wants a revised benefits case before sign-off. The request goes to the steering committee at the next quarterly review. The context you will need before that meeting appears below.

management briefing: Jorixax Holdings is in early talks to buy Casixax Holdings for about $420.3 million. The Fenmir launch date is October 27, and nothing goes to the press before then. Legal wants the Keloxek Foods term sheet redrafted before April 16.